Subject: [PATCH 33/36] IB: convert struct class_device to struct device
Date: Sun, 20 Apr 2008 03:46:03 -0700	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<1208688366-9252-33-git-send-email-gregkh@suse.de>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20080420104516.GA9225@suse.de>

From: Tony Jones <tonyj@suse.de>

This converts the main ib_device to use struct device instead of struct
class_device as class_device is going away.
